APM with Entrust Identity guard token not asking to pick a new PIN
Hello Everyone,
Here is a summary of the issue. We have an access policy that allows users to login to some remote apps using AD + token pin (so basically two factor authentication). If the user has their PIN already set then the page works beautifully.
The issue starts if a new pin is assigned to the token or the PIN has been reset. The user types in their AD credentials then the temporary PIN + token code and in a perfect world they would get a new page or a prompt to enter in a new PIN, re-enter the new pin and then login with the new pin information.
Using wireshark I can see the proper radius information being passed and I can hack my way through it but a regular user needs to see those prompts to know what they need to do.
Long story short has anyone got this working with APM and Entrust tokens?
